Letsfly Unveils New Brand Strategy to Build a One-Stop Distribution Infrastructure for the Global Travel Ecosystem

By CharlotteApril 14, 20263 Mins Read
Share
Facebook Twitter Pinterest Email Copy Link


On April 14, 2026, Letsfly, a leading global travel technology company, announced the launch of its new brand strategy on its 12th anniversary. With this upgrade, Letsfly officially positions itself as “a one-stop distribution infrastructure for the global travel ecosystem.”

 

As part of this strategic evolution, Letsfly has integrated its two core solutions — AeroHub (Air) and HiBeds (Hotel) — under a unified brand architecture. This move strengthens synergy across its offerings and enables the company to deliver more cohesive, end-to-end distribution capabilities across both air and hotel sectors.

 

Since its founding in 2014, Letsfly has been focused on simplifying the complexity of global travel distribution through technology. Over the past 12 years, the company has built a highly efficient value network connecting supply and demand at scale. Today, Letsfly connects over 650 airlines, including more than 100 direct integrations, and aggregates close to one million hotels across 140+ countries and regions. On the demand side, its global distribution network serves more than 1,000 partners, including leading OTAs, wholesalers, and travel agencies.

 

As part of the brand upgrade, Letsfly also reinforces its long-term mission: “Connecting Travel. Delivering Trust.”This vision is supported by its two core solutions.

 

AeroHub — Global Air Content Solution AeroHub integrates air content via a unified API, connects over 650 airlines, including more than 100 direct integrations. Multiple cooperation models (Faremarket, TechHub, TechHub+) provide partners with one-stop content and tech support.

 

HiBeds — Global Hotel Content Solution HiBeds connects 980,000+ hotels worldwide via a singe interface. It offers reliable delivery, competitive rates, and handles 3 billion daily searches, with averages 0.2s response time, and 93% price validation accuracy.

 

“Over the past 12 years, we have remained focused on making travel distribution simpler,” said Gordon Liu, CEO of Letsfly. “As the industry evolves, stronger infrastructure will drive the next phase of growth. Our vision is to build a unified foundation that not only advances the industry but also empowers our global partners to grow.”

 

Looking ahead, Letsfly will continue expanding its global footprint while leveraging emerging technologies such as AI to further enhance connectivity, efficiency, and scalability across the travel ecosystem.
